It's Showtime...The Interview
BEFORE:
- Research, research, research!
- Know organization's major products/services.
- Chain of command.
- Appropriate salary ranges.
- Job requirements of position you are applying for.
- Know your strengths.
- Your long and short term goals
- Prepare a list of questions to ask.
- Confirm date, time and place of interview.
DURING
- Dress appropriately; good grooming
- Be on time (5 minutes early)
- Maintain eye contact.
- Be pleasant and courteous.
- No nervous habits (tapping foot, smoking, etc).
- Allow interviewer to take the lead in questioning
- Select words careful- take a few seconds to prepare answer, and then respond.
- Avoid slang.
- Do not criticize past employer.
- Maintain a positive attitude - no negatives.
- Attempt to limit responses to 60 seconds each.
- Attend to non-verbal cues.
- Tell what you do well.
- Say 'thank you'.
AFTER
- Make notes soon after leaving interview.
- WRITE THANK YOU NOTES!
- Follow up contacts.
- Consider changes for future interviews
